CodeGen: Make atomic operations play nice with address spaces
authorDavid Majnemer <david.majnemer@gmail.com>
Sat, 22 Nov 2014 10:44:12 +0000 (10:44 +0000)
committerDavid Majnemer <david.majnemer@gmail.com>
Sat, 22 Nov 2014 10:44:12 +0000 (10:44 +0000)
commitd8cd8f7b6ea236d3fefec3e50738645cf470712b
tree864d4f9bfef3bd53299fac93ccb6665064ac2596
parent5852b1f4c28fbaa42413a1b3ca7401ac314e4336
CodeGen: Make atomic operations play nice with address spaces

We were being a little sloppy with our pointer/address space casts.

This fixes PR21643.

llvm-svn: 222615
clang/lib/CodeGen/CGAtomic.cpp
clang/test/CodeGen/atomic-ops.c